Establish a Classification System for Efficient Junk Removal
A well-organized sorting system is essential for optimizing the junk removal process. By organizing items, people can more easily determine what to retain, donate, recycle, or discard. The first step involves collecting containers or bags labeled for each category. This visual aid assists in maintaining focus during the sorting activity.
Following this, people should methodically handle each section, organizing items into their corresponding containers as they work. It is advisable to be candid about the value of each item, asking whether it provides value or joy. Using a timer can also increase productivity, encouraging swift decisions and limiting second-guessing.
After sorting is finished, the next step is to transfer items from the designated containers to their final destinations. This systematic approach not only simplifies the junk removal process but also promotes a sense of accomplishment, ultimately leading to a more orderly and serene living space.

Collect Your Essential Decluttering Essentials
While beginning a decluttering journey, having the right tools readily available can greatly enhance the process. Essential tools include sturdy boxes or bins for sorting items into categories such as keep, donate, and discard. Labeling materials, including markers and adhesive labels, help guarantee that each box is easily identifiable, streamlining the decision-making process. A tape measure can also be helpful for determining if indeed larger items fit into designated spaces.
Furthermore, garbage bags are essential for quickly disposing of unwanted items. For items that demand special handling, such as electronics or hazardous materials, it's crucial to have a plan and appropriate containers. Finally, a notebook or digital app can assist in tracking progress and jotting down notes regarding future organization. By arming yourself with these key decluttering tools, the journey toward a better organized and clutter-free space becomes noticeably more manageable.
Strategies for Enduring Organization After Organizing
Building long-term organization after decluttering necessitates consistent habits and strategic planning. To keep an organized space, individuals should adopt a routine for regular tidying. This can include allocating a particular time each week to review belongings and return items to their assigned places.
Utilizing storage solutions, such as bins or shelves, can also help organize items categorized and easily accessible. Labeling these storage containers assures clarity, making it easier to locate necessary items without searching through clutter.
In addition, embracing a one-in-one-out strategy can stop future accumulation. This implies that for every new item brought into the home, an old item should be eliminated.
In conclusion, periodically reviewing the space and belongings can assist in recognize any new clutter and address it immediately, fostering a sustainable organizational system. By applying these guidelines, individuals can enjoy a clutter-free environment for the long term.

Hazardous Substance Handling
Handling hazardous materials requires expertise and careful consideration, as incorrect disposal can present serious health and safety risks. Items like batteries, paints, chemicals, and electronic waste contain substances that can negatively impact the environment and human health if not dealt with appropriately. It is crucial for individuals to identify when these materials are present and to be aware of the legal regulations related to their disposal. In cases involving hazardous waste, engaging professional junk removal services is advisable. These experts are qualified to safely manage and dispose of hazardous materials safely and in compliance with local laws. By calling in the pros, individuals can ensure their space is decluttered without compromising safety or the environment.

What Are the Proper Steps to Recycle Electronic Waste?
For proper electronic waste recycling, one should identify certified e-waste recycling centers, follow local regulations, and ensure devices are erased of personal data prior to disposal. This promotes environmental sustainability and reduces harmful landfill impact.

Am I Able to Donate Items That Are Broken or Damaged?
Donating non-working or damaged items is generally discouraged, as many organizations prefer functional goods. Nonetheless, some charitable organizations may receive them for restoration purposes. It's advisable to reach out directly with the specific organization before contributing.
